If you use any limited message size social networking (like Twitter) or if you simply need to shorten any URL for use in your email campaign (or anywhere else), Boomerang now offers a Firefox extension to help you in this task. The extension is called Boomerang Hotlink Manager and is available to download from Mozilla.org’s Firefox add-on’s site.

Benefits
This extension allows you to grab the URL in the URL bar or by grabbing the URL from a link on a page and convert it into a URL in the form of http://boomerang.com/zwa. You can use these shorter URLs in place of any longer URL. The URLs will be redirected automatically to the original location.
